    Abstract:

    The genetic diversity of maize landraces in Shanxi was studied based on SSR markers and bulk samples. Totally 368 alleles in 38 OPVs were detected with an average of 7.48 ranged from 2 to 14 per locus. PIC among the 38 varieties ranged from 0.24 to 0.89。Also 185 rare alleles and 21 unique alleles were identified. The 38 landraces were clustered into 4 groups. It suggested that genetic diversity of maize landraces in Shanxi are very rich and they contains many own alleles that means they have some special characterization. The maize landraces in Shanxi may play great role in broadening the genetic base of germplasm in maize.
